WebCyberliterature created in the postmodern context conspicuously possesses the cultural features of postmodernism and the basic representation is its game spirit. In cyberliterature, literature is regarded not only as a serious mission, but also a kind of amusement and games. People even lay more emphasis on the fun of the works on the …
